The Unique Challenges of Hyperlocal Delivery
Speed Pressure Creates Communication Gaps
Traditional e-commerce gives you days to resolve issues. Hyperlocal gives you minutes. Consider the typical quick commerce order:
Timeline of a 10-minute delivery:
- 0:00 - Order placed
- 0:30 - Order confirmed, picker starts
- 3:00 - Items picked and packed
- 4:00 - Handed to delivery partner
- 10:00 - Delivered
There's no time for back-and-forth emails. No room for "we'll call you back." Every communication must be instant, clear, and actionable.
Common issues that derail hyperlocal deliveries:
- Customer not reachable at delivery time
- Incorrect or incomplete address details
- Building entry restrictions or gate codes
- Customer wants to modify order mid-transit
- Delivery partner can't find the location
Each of these issues, if not resolved within seconds, results in a failed delivery. And in hyperlocal, failed deliveries aren't just lost revenue - they're lost reputation.

Address Verification Before Dispatch
In hyperlocal, every minute counts. Sending a delivery partner to the wrong address wastes 15-20 minutes - an eternity when you've promised 10-minute delivery.
The address accuracy problem:
Many customers enter addresses like:
- "Near SBI ATM, Sector 15" (which SBI ATM?)
- "Blue gate building" (there are three blue gates)
- "Behind the temple" (helpful in a city with thousands of temples)
AI voice agents solve this by calling immediately after order placement:
Sample conversation:
AI Agent: "Hi, this is a call from QuickMart regarding your order. I see your delivery address is Sector 15, near SBI ATM. Could you confirm the exact building name or any landmark our delivery partner can look for?"
Customer: "Oh yes, it's Sunrise Apartments, Tower B, the gate is right after the ATM"
AI Agent: "Got it - Sunrise Apartments, Tower B, right after the SBI ATM. And which floor?"
Customer: "Third floor, flat 302"
AI Agent: "Perfect, 3rd floor flat 302. Your order will arrive in about 8 minutes. Is there anything else you'd like to add?"
This 45-second call can save a 20-minute delivery failure.
High-Impact Use Cases for Hyperlocal Delivery
1. Order Confirmation Calls (COD Orders)
Cash on delivery remains king in India, accounting for 60-70% of orders in many categories. But COD orders have a dark side: 15-25% RTO (Return to Origin) rates.
Many COD orders are placed impulsively, by mistake, or with incorrect details. AI voice agents can verify intent immediately:
Within 60 seconds of order:
- Confirm the customer actually placed the order
- Verify the delivery address
- Confirm the payment mode and amount
- Offer a chance to modify or cancel
Results we've seen:
- 30% reduction in RTO for COD orders
- 40% fewer "customer not interested" returns
- Faster fraud detection (wrong numbers, repeated cancellers)
2. Pre-Delivery Coordination
The window between "order dispatched" and "order delivered" is where most failures happen. AI voice agents can make this critical period seamless:
Trigger: 5 minutes before expected arrival
AI Agent: "Hi! Your QuickMart order with [items] is about 5 minutes away. Will you be available to receive it?"
If customer is available: Great, the call ends in 10 seconds.
If customer is busy: The agent offers alternatives - leave with security, reschedule to specific time, leave at door.
If customer doesn't answer: The agent tries again in 2 minutes, then notifies the delivery partner of potential delay.
3. Failed Delivery Recovery

The ROI of Voice AI in Hyperlocal
Let's do the math for a medium-sized food delivery platform doing 5,000 orders per day:
Current State (Without Voice AI)
| Metric | Value | Impact |
|---|---|---|
| Daily orders | 5,000 | - |
| Failed delivery rate | 12% | 600 failures/day |
| Cost per failure | Rs. 150 | Includes redelivery, food waste, refund |
| Daily failure cost | Rs. 90,000 | - |
| Monthly failure cost | Rs. 27 lakhs | Significant drain on margins |
With Voice AI
| Metric | Value | Impact |
|---|---|---|
| COD confirmation calls | 3,000/day | 60% of orders are COD |
| Pre-delivery calls | 5,000/day | All orders |
| Failed delivery rate | 7% | 5% improvement |
| Failures prevented | 250/day | - |
| Daily savings | Rs. 37,500 | From prevented failures |
| AI voice cost | Rs. 8,000/day | At Rs. 1/call average |
| Net daily savings | Rs. 29,500 | - |
| Monthly savings | Rs. 8.85 lakhs | - |

Low-Latency Requirements: Why Speed Matters
In hyperlocal, even your AI needs to be fast. When a delivery partner is waiting outside and calls the customer, they expect an immediate response. A slow, laggy AI voice agent creates frustration.
Target latency for hyperlocal voice agents:
- Response time: Under 500ms (feels conversational)
- Call connection: Under 2 seconds
- Handoff to human: Under 5 seconds when needed

Hinglish: The Reality of Urban India
Most urban Indians don't speak pure Hindi or pure English - they speak Hinglish. Your AI agents should too:
Pure Hindi (sounds robotic): "Aapka order bhej diya gaya hai. Delivery shukrawar tak hogi."
Hinglish (sounds natural): "Aapka order ship ho gaya hai, delivery Friday tak expected hai."

Implementation Guide: Getting Started
Step 1: Identify Your Highest-Impact Use Case
Don't try to automate everything at once. Start with one use case:
If COD is your biggest problem: Start with order confirmation calls If delivery failures hurt most: Start with pre-delivery coordination If customer feedback is lacking: Start with post-delivery calls
Step 2: Integrate with Your Order Management System
Your voice agent needs real-time data. Connect:
- Order status (placed, preparing, dispatched, delivered)
- Customer phone numbers
- Delivery partner assignment
- Address details
- Past order history (for context)
We provide webhooks and APIs for all major platforms. Custom integrations typically take 2-3 days.
Step 3: Configure Your Voice Agent
Basic configuration for a hyperlocal delivery agent:
{
"agent": {
"name": "Delivery Coordinator",
"language": "hi-IN",
"llmProvider": "gemini-2.5",
"llmModel": "gemini-2.5-flash-lite",
"llmTemperature": 0.3,
"sttProvider": "deepgram",
"sttModel": "nova-3",
"ttsProvider": "azure",
"ttsVoice": "hi-IN-SwaraNeural",
"greetingMessage": "Namaste! Yeh QuickMart ki taraf se call hai aapke order ke baare mein.",
"prompt": "You are a delivery coordinator for QuickMart. Speak in Hinglish. Your goal is to confirm the customer is available for delivery and verify the address. Be brief and friendly."
}
}For complete setup instructions, see our quick start guide.
Step 4: Set Up Automation Triggers
Connect your order events to voice calls:
| Event | Call Type | Timing |
|---|---|---|
| Order placed (COD) | Confirmation | Immediate |
| Order dispatched | Pre-delivery | 5 min before ETA |
| Delivery failed | Recovery | Immediate |
| Order delivered | Feedback | 15 min after |
Step 5: Monitor and Optimize
Track these metrics from day one:
- Call answer rate - Target: >80%
- Confirmation rate - Target: >90%
- Average call duration - Target: <60 seconds
- Failed delivery improvement - Track weekly trend
- Customer satisfaction - Post-call survey
